Received: by 10.223.176.46 with SMTP id f43csp1109932wra; Wed, 24 Jan 2018 10:47:19 -0800 (PST) X-Google-Smtp-Source: AH8x2260YvE7wcUaQ6zZDmDfawyxObYkYWBJcQ6TxSAERIJ5O+02DEIIS+Xm7jhJBoyjjhRn3/0a X-Received: by 2002:a17:902:8f8a:: with SMTP id z10-v6mr8676567plo.395.1516819638977; Wed, 24 Jan 2018 10:47:18 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1516819638; cv=none; d=google.com; s=arc-20160816; b=rFxvVv3EuUbEsPGnekWcTkoOmFILPIoq+ql+a+pBT8t0199751bc//YvwXbUP0lCDk a7+l2LhnOgV3X0iSoPUGMZtZjJSFUw3jWq6x98PrhsBCOSUOC+bBQWw37TDc5DT+WSSi IEClTyrgU8nQmMElJojsIewGTXVY/DAhI1mmXkYXQUqlV0neYTFUqb74zQBbQq1fOwmC omhyg4k3jMcqwpq4nsWUtKtuiSi0JpiGaFFhvYxD4ILVYb/3QHTyPgu9K/FUYyi7Spvy c1afQZOoyhTVUXXa3SuROdMiuakkxcUSuQX/Lkt38Q7ad3lSaoHHu2SE44Jp6WSyJoNy nLyw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:user-agent:in-reply-to :content-disposition:mime-version:references:message-id:subject:cc :to:from:date:dkim-signature:arc-authentication-results; bh=GjiaOJy/NdJK4xHc/PTKCD9yGebB8ucxTF1Rpdx1wfI=; b=Dji4erruvofpq8wZcF1qMLl49wfX7w7IlAhFknDov8b3AXnSLbF954IawT6f21bwyq 8AaHHFFxn+R0Mh33jK3Q/b4q9Q7fqsObk8sU6dlGEbIlGcryMc+kUPnjVbuPJt2yqZQ6 bnqZJjaz0+KYNDr8+h0BEFWChNiT3w6G+D9I5dUjLiQIGdnjZECjewMntnGAnwF0rc10 Q/UhHNruZIRPgLls+Zm3eO4auxmCa76AsUPHcv/2of4zgoxAlrefKGwml789+2oxHEDP xqAlPr8oARPHGq2poVeKhc1frSQcBWYGoi2OrBIjpyhU2pk8d4pyeH98rMio3U50D6du 6pyg== ARC-Authentication-Results: i=1; mx.google.com; dkim=fail header.i=@gmail.com header.s=20161025 header.b=XaT3sxOs;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id y10si3293881pff.240.2018.01.24.10.47.04; Wed, 24 Jan 2018 10:47:18 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=fail header.i=@gmail.com header.s=20161025 header.b=XaT3sxOs;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S965067AbeAXSqM (ORCPT + 99 others); Wed, 24 Jan 2018 13:46:12 -0500 Received: from mail-qt0-f172.google.com ([209.85.216.172]:39245 "EHLO mail-qt0-f172.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S964989AbeAXSqK (ORCPT ); Wed, 24 Jan 2018 13:46:10 -0500 Received: by mail-qt0-f172.google.com with SMTP id f4so12932794qtj.6 for ; Wed, 24 Jan 2018 10:46:10 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=sender:date:from:to:cc:subject:message-id:references:mime-version :content-disposition:in-reply-to:user-agent; bh=GjiaOJy/NdJK4xHc/PTKCD9yGebB8ucxTF1Rpdx1wfI=; b=XaT3sxOsgVLMnt5OmpBBs8Wdf7dYUYtbRBkv9nSbEmDC7jxOq8uGqBQNVVjYPXx4qu sA5RWUBrgnACCSnnnbdZTg3k8CpVjrWwmK8QS+AE+jeLR3K3w5ja9lc83SWypQy6IRWp VBUsoR7AejfsoXzOXgtIXLGTo+uHB6zLq9S0bZSrpD2mqN78ttVbnefcWdD0q000n5PQ fuj5OBLwHi0nYWkO/vMXGCshIm/SjWCuiIyM/OeBdnQy/dPZ0kdFqzdYDNj5DN96VlE9 eVJmvChBLlAIbzATS8vVdL4KSVAOc3tMDWG3gi840lchc2EPZCdf5pWX1Oi73v99a7ze HvxA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:sender:date:from:to:cc:subject:message-id :references:mime-version:content-disposition:in-reply-to:user-agent; bh=GjiaOJy/NdJK4xHc/PTKCD9yGebB8ucxTF1Rpdx1wfI=; b=QAC2Fc529xpIfWOCMqef3HSm5OG32xeARuU8fSCaZY0BYzP8dTzyHcXOunlV0SnVWr RR5talufr3RfeGWmZmxsUCBb82Ddmoyvn+qeGGX9h8Q2pLAxhi3BnlsCajhqfqqaZ9d/ 3DagBIxy6QLEsZjm5M5FG0whTnNqOIZdAqOXSxnFclgOr8Gd6hk8iUHI6n9n4ykibgcp evUKpmcF+JV1WKGaa4hVccty+HUBVN3unbkbL+7Mroud2pPIZJGyTFtWX6YNgfeLXTv+ fW6eN3zVRq+LXpH+5BvMBVg9L4FNYBWhieDaQjPKTnE/Mf/XMIBU98M6BkwDvlyypwIz ZzUQ== X-Gm-Message-State: AKwxyteSIEc0g3kVGfpsQ4dOP+qUVDTLkyPht/KN4OCQRVU0nHK3/CAn 9JMMr/6TxnSsbCcDpKaSK8M= X-Received: by 10.55.41.147 with SMTP id p19mr8062771qkp.208.1516819569921; Wed, 24 Jan 2018 10:46:09 -0800 (PST) Received: from localhost (dhcp-ec-8-6b-ed-7a-cf.cpe.echoes.net. [72.28.5.223]) by smtp.gmail.com with ESMTPSA id d26sm2648819qtk.54.2018.01.24.10.46.08 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Wed, 24 Jan 2018 10:46:09 -0800 (PST) Date: Wed, 24 Jan 2018 10:46:06 -0800 From: Tejun Heo To: Peter Zijlstra Cc: Petr Mladek , Linus Torvalds , akpm@linux-foundation.org, Steven Rostedt , Sergey Senozhatsky , linux-mm@kvack.org, Cong Wang , Dave Hansen , Johannes Weiner , Mel Gorman , Michal Hocko , Vlastimil Babka , Jan Kara , Mathieu Desnoyers , Tetsuo Handa , rostedt@home.goodmis.org, Byungchul Park , Sergey Senozhatsky , Pavel Machek , linux-kernel@vger.kernel.org Subject: Re: [PATCH v5 0/2] printk: Console owner and waiter logic cleanup Message-ID: <20180124184606.GA17457@devbig577.frc2.facebook.com> References: <20180110132418.7080-1-pmladek@suse.com> <20180110140547.GZ3668920@devbig577.frc2.facebook.com> <20180110162900.GA21753@linux.suse> <20180110170223.GF3668920@devbig577.frc2.facebook.com> <20180124093607.GK2269@hirez.programming.kicks-ass.net>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<20180124093607.GK2269@hirez.programming.kicks-ass.net> User-Agent: Mutt/1.5.21 (2010-09-15)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hello, Peter. On Wed, Jan 24, 2018 at 10:36:07AM +0100, Peter Zijlstra wrote: > On Wed, Jan 10, 2018 at 09:02:23AM -0800, Tejun Heo wrote: > > 1. Console is IPMI emulated serial console. Super slow. Also > > netconsole is in use. > > So my IPMI SoE typically run at 115200 Baud (or higher) and I've not had > trouble like that (granted I don't typically trigger OOM storms, but > they do occasionally happen). > > Is your IPMI much slower and not fixable to be faster? It looks like the latest machines have the baud rate at 57600 and I'm pretty sure we have a lot of slower ones. 57600 isn't 9600 but is still slow enough to get into trouble often enough. There are a huge number of machines running all sorts of things under heavy load and trying to rapidly deploy new kernels / features contributes to encountering bugs and weird corner cases. UART can run a lot faster and I have no idea why IPMI consoles behave as if they were connected over mile-long DB9 cables. Maybe we can convince hardware people to improve it but, even if that happened today, we'd still be looking at years of dealing with slower ones, and IPMI situation here is likely better than what many others are facing. idk, it's not a particularly difficult problem to solve from kernel side. Just need to figure out a better / more robust trade-off. Thanks. -- tejun